Output e716589bc8a76c342207bddda5cb60c35a9a20dbbc947d2eaa22a05a3cf810c6:16

value
1581716
script pubkey
OP_0 OP_PUSHBYTES_20 7d7eda17206877b53208a6e7623c8af695f9e9e3
address
bc1q04ld59eqdpmm2vsg5mnky0y2762ln60rl573y7
transaction
e716589bc8a76c342207bddda5cb60c35a9a20dbbc947d2eaa22a05a3cf810c6
spent
true